Arguably the finest slice in town comes from a no-frills shop front in Midwood, Brooklyn, about a 40-minute subway ride from Midtown. Store owner Domenico DeMarco, who was born in Italy, is in his late 70s and insists on making every pizza himself, which explains the wait. The queues start ahead of the shop opens at 12 (1pm on Sundays - DeMarco goes to church), and on weekends you will wait anyplace between 30 minutes to three hours.
